Each element has a unique number of protons, and this number is what gives the element its atomic number and place in the periodic table.<\/p>\n\n\n\n<p>For <strong>oxygen<\/strong>, the atomic number is <strong>8<\/strong>, which means that every atom of oxygen has <strong>8 protons in its nucleus<\/strong>. This is the key characteristic that distinguishes oxygen from all other elements. If the number of protons were to change, the atom would no longer be oxygen; it would become a different element entirely.<\/p>\n\n\n\n<p>Now, in a <strong>neutral atom<\/strong>, the number of <strong>electrons<\/strong> equals the number of protons. So a neutral oxygen atom also has <strong>8 electrons<\/strong>. These electrons are arranged in <strong>energy levels or shells<\/strong> around the nucleus. The first shell can hold up to 2 electrons, and the second shell can hold up to 8 electrons. For oxygen, 2 electrons fill the first shell, and the remaining 6 go into the second shell\u2014not 8. Therefore, the option that says \u201ca second shell with 8 electrons\u201d is incorrect.<\/p>\n\n\n\n<p>Additionally, oxygen does <strong>not have electrons in 8 shells<\/strong>. It only has <strong>2 occupied shells<\/strong>. Atoms with electrons in 8 shells belong to elements with much higher atomic numbers (well beyond 100).<\/p>\n\n\n\n<p>Lastly, <strong>atomic mass<\/strong> is a separate concept from atomic number. The atomic mass of oxygen is approximately <strong>16<\/strong>, which is the sum of the protons and neutrons in the nucleus, not 8.<\/p>\n\n\n\n<p>In conclusion, <strong>oxygen has an atomic number of 8 because it contains 8 protons in its nucleus<\/strong>, and this is what defines it as the element oxygen.
